自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(24)
  • 资源 (3)
  • 收藏
  • 关注

原创 C#中的DataTable怎么获取已删除行的信息

<br />C#的DataTable的行有几种状态:Added:表示行已添加到DataRowCollection,尚未调用DataTable.AcceptChange()Modified:表示行已被修改,尚未调用DataTable.AcceptChange()Deleted:表示行已被删除,Unchanged:自上次调用AcceptChange()之后没有更改的行.Detached:行虽然创建,但没有放到DataRowCollection中. 有时候,要获取到客户端表格的删除行,然后再提交到数据库更新.但是

2010-09-29 12:50:00 4529

原创 Microsoft Silverlight 4 Tools for Visual Studio 2010 下载

<br />微软正式发布 Silverlight 4 Tools for VS 2010。 <br />Silverlight 4 Tools for VS 2010 可以从以下两个链接下载到: <br />Download details page: http://go.microsoft.com/fwlink/?LinkId=177428 <br />Direct download package: http://go.microsoft.com/fwlink/?LinkId=177508 <br />

2010-09-08 18:35:00 3680

转载 SSO解决方案大全(cookie跨域)

<br />前段时间为我们的系统做SSO(单点登录)参考了很多资料,其中包括博客园二级域名的登录.翻译本文是由于作者的一句话:思想都是一样的,只不过实现起来需要创造性思维.<br /><br />Single Sign-On (SSO)是近来的热门话题. 很多和我交往的客户中都有不止一个运行在.Net框架中的Web应用程序或者若干子域名.而他们甚至希望在不同的域名中也可以只登陆一次就可以畅游所有站点.今天我们关注的是如何在各种不同的应用场景中实现 SSO. 我们由简到繁,逐一攻破. <br />虚拟目录的主

2010-07-30 08:45:00 7302

转载 单点登录的实现思路

在项目开发的过程中,经常会出现这样的情况:我们的产品包括很多,如多个Web网站(前台、会员空间、管理平台等等)、C/S架构程序、客户关系系统等等,传统的身份验证方式已经大大的阻碍了我们各个产品之间的耦合性,应用传统的身份验证方式,我们必须要在每一个应用中进行登录操作,才可以应用这一产品。如果我们开发一个网站,那么在不同的应用之间如何共享登录信息呢?以前的解决方案一般会通过Session复制来完成,但是Session复制必须要应用在集群中,集群的搭建又会有这样那样的问题,所以经过很长时间的研究,包括关注微软.

2010-06-29 20:03:00 755

原创 SSO跨域解决方案

单点登录(Single Sign On),简称为 SSO,是目前比较流行的企业业务整合的解决方案之一。SSO的定义是在多个应用系统中,用户只需要登录一次就可以访问所有相互信任的应用系统。它包括可以将这次主要的登录映射到其他应用中用于同一个用户的登录的机制。<br />当用户第一次访问应用系统1的时候,因为还没有登录,会被引导到认证系统中进行登录;根据用户提供的登录信息,认证系统进行身份效验,如果通过效验,应该返回给用户一个认证的凭据--ticket;用户再访问别的应用的时候就会将这个ticket带上,作为自

2010-06-29 19:54:00 746

原创 跨域(cross-domain)访问 cookie (读取和设置)

<br />Passport 一方面意味着用一个帐号可以在不同服务里登录,另一方面就是在一个服务里面登录后可以无障碍的漫游到其他服务里面去。坦白说,目前 sohu passport 在这一点实现的很烂(不过俺的工作就是要把它做好啦,hehe)<br />搜狐的 SSO 需求比较麻烦,因为它旗下有好多域名:sohu.com、chinaren.com、sogou.com、focus.cn、17173.com、go2map.com,登录用户漫游的主要障碍也来自于此。<br />以前亿邮的邮件系统在和别的系统整合的

2010-06-29 19:48:00 591

原创 ASP.NET 2.0: Implementing Single Sign On (SSO) with Membership API

<br />原文URL:http://blah.winsmarts.com/2006/05/19/aspnet-20-implementing-single-sign-on-sso-with-membership-api.aspx<br /> <br />The membership API is awesome. No doubt about that. But I wish it had a more obvious in-built support for SSO. The only authenti

2010-06-29 19:38:00 656

转载 有用的文档

我是个反文档主义者,最主要的原因是因为我很懒,其实是不会写。随着开发项目的越来越大,开始认识到有些文档是不得不写的:一. 常规的有用文档1. 记录需求的文档,一切之起源,比如Scrum中的Backlog。2. 记录跟踪BUG的文档或工具,这点重要性勿容质疑。3. 描述高层次架构设计的文档,虽然面对面交流比文档要好,可是对于架构这种涉及关联复杂,跨时间性长的文档,是必需要用文档描述的,随

2010-05-08 11:22:00 350

转载 怎样把自己培养成为一个优秀的程序员

态度篇1. 做实事:不要抱怨,发牢骚,指责他人,找出问题所在,想办法解决。对问题和错误,要勇于承担。2. 欲速则不达:用小聪明、权宜之计解决问题,求快而不顾代码质量,会给项目留下要命的死角。3. 对事不对人:就事论事,明智、真诚、虚心地讨论问题,提出创新方案。4. 排除万难,奋勇前进:勇气往往是克服困难的唯一方法。学习篇5. 跟踪变化:新技术层出不穷并不可怕。坚持学习新

2010-05-08 11:20:00 378

原创 window对话框父子相互访问

父页面:          Height="400" ShowOnLoad="false" Modal="true" Constrain="true" Title ="编辑页面" Hidden ="true" >                    ShowMask="true" />                                                      

2010-05-07 15:48:00 887 2

原创 Button按钮删除确认框三种方法

 前台aspx代码:        function deleteConfirm() {            return confirm("是否删除");        }                                                                                                        

2010-05-05 11:23:00 3240

原创 将网站变为灰色的方法

今天互联网上有很多网站都已经将网站页面改为黑灰的素色来哀悼地震中的受难者。现在,给大家讲一下网站变成黑灰色的代码,希望有更多的站长加入这场哀悼中!使用方法:最简单的把页面变成灰色的代码是在head 之间加html {FILTER: gray}第一情况:把下面代码复制到你网页的中就可以了实现BODY {filter:progid:DXImageTransform.Microsoft.

2010-04-21 08:32:00 1604

转载 让Windows Server 2008+IIS 7+ASP.NET支持10万个同时请求

本文转自:http://www.cnblogs.com/dudu/archive/2009/11/10/1600062.htmlError Summary: HTTP Error 503.2 - Service UnavailableThe serverRuntime@appConcurrentRequestLimit setting is being exceeded. Detail

2010-03-31 23:04:00 474

原创 解决iframe跨域读写Cookies的问题,(ASP、ASP.NET、PHP、JSP)解决方案

A站iframe引用其它站(B站)的内容时,B站的页面获取不到B站种下的Cookies。如果页面是来自框架的,而框架的父页和框架不是一个站点的话,客户端默认是禁止向页面附加头信息的,这样服务器端就无法识别客户端框架里面的页面,自然不能操作Session。 解决方案:一种是:直接改IIS设置在IIS设置中,header头中加对值:P3PCP="CAO PSA OUR"第二种是:直接在

2010-03-29 09:43:00 868

原创 数据库优化脚本

 analyze   table  cust_cm estimate statistics sample 30 percent;analyze   table  cust_cm compute statistics; analyze TABLE cust_cm DELETE STATISTICS;

2010-03-19 16:24:00 499

原创 JS重置按钮脚本,支持重置ASP.NET控件

开发中经常遇到要重置控件值得操作,下面写了常用HTML控件的重置方法。不完整的,大家可以扩充function ResetControl() {            var v = document.forms[0].elements;            for (var i = 0; i                 if (v[i].type == "text") {        

2010-03-09 11:31:00 1964

原创 设置DataGridView控件DataGridViewComboBoxColumn下拉框默认值

 DataGridViewComboBoxColumn salColumn = new DataGridViewComboBoxColumn();salColumn .Items.Add("张三");salColumn .Items.Add("李四");salColumn .Items.Add("王五"); salColumn .DefaultCellStyle.NullV

2010-01-30 10:42:00 5099 2

原创 ORACLE数据库导入导出

exp /@itsmdb as sysdba file=expitsm.exp log=expitsm.log owner=itsmuserset ORACLE_SID=ITSMDBimp / as sysdba file=itsmuser.exp fromuser=itsmuser touser=itsmuser log=impitsmuser.log

2010-01-21 17:01:00 540

原创 HRESULT:0x80070057 (E_INVALIDARG)的异常的解决方案

未能加载文件或程序集……或它的某一个依赖项。参数不正确。 (异常来自 HRESULT:0x80070057 (E_INVALIDARG))中文版:未能加载文件或程序集……或它的某一个依赖项。参数不正确。 (异常来自 HRESULT:0x80070057 (E_INVALIDARG)) English:Could not load file or assembly … The par

2010-01-17 18:57:00 1917

原创 sqlserver重建所有索引存储过程

CREATE proc [dbo].[reBuildIndex]asdeclare @statement NVARCHAR(1000)declare mycursor cursor forSELECT ALTER INDEX [ + ix.name + ] ON [ + s.name + ].[ + t.name + ] REBUILD WITH ( PAD_INDEX  = OFF

2010-01-16 17:18:00 1693

原创 SQL日期格式化应用大全

Sql Server 中一个非常强大的日期格式化函数Select CONVERT(varchar(100), GETDATE(), 0): 05 16 2006 10:57AMSelect CONVERT(varchar(100), GETDATE(), 1): 05/16/06Select CONVERT(varchar(100), GETDATE(), 2): 06.05.16Select

2010-01-16 17:16:00 386

原创 Asp.net利用ExcelLibrary输出EXCEL

 public void DataTable2Excel(string attachName, DataTable tab)        {            string file = HttpContext.Current.Server.MapPath("/uploads/export/" + Guid.NewGuid().ToString() + ".xls");           

2010-01-08 13:42:00 4056 1

原创 asp.net导入导出EXCEL

导入EXCEL一般有3种方法1.通过Excel APIl来导入(缺点,需要安装OFFICE组件,建立对象后,不容易释放,大数据量时读取速度较低)2.通过OLEDB数据源方式读取3.通过第三方组件来导入(推荐使用ExcelLibrary)下载地址:http://code.google.com/p/excellibrary/ 同样导出EXCEL也有3种方法,和导入类似。 推

2010-01-08 11:31:00 838

原创 c#开发中的编码转换问题

我们在开发中,经常碰到编码转换的问题,发现一个系统自带的好用的小函数。HttpUtility.UrlEncode使用方法:string strGb2312=HttpUtility.UrlEncode("中国人", Encoding.GetEncoding("gb2312")); //GB2312编码string strUTF8=HttpUtility.UrlEncode("中国人");

2010-01-07 13:03:00 531 1

控笔训练专业版笔画训练40页.pdf

控笔训练专业版笔画训练,可以打印,给小孩子用的,分享给大家

2020-08-21

C#2.0语言参考手册

C#2.0语法,开发和学习过程中的必备参考资料。

2008-09-05

css2.0速查学习手册

大家开发过程中经常用到CSS编写,上传一个CSS速查手册,供大家学习之用。

2008-09-05

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除